    Features
    • Polygonal and Circular area creation. (Not just cuboids!)
    • In-game zone creation.
    • Provide a Circular border to your map.
    • Hierarchical Permissions with Child and Parent Zones.
    • Display Entering and Exiting messages in chat.
    • Enhanced /who
    • Advanced control of zone based regeneration
    • Many zone specific controls for things like Fire, Explosions and Mob spawning control

    jblaske

    Whoever you want to be able to create and manipulate zones, you would give epiczones.admin access.

    If you want somebody do be able to do whatever they want regardless of the restrictiongs on build/destroy/entry in a zone, give them epiczones.ignorepermissions

    If you want somebody to be able to make changes to a specific zone that you have defined. Make them an owner of that zone. If somebody is the owner of a zone, they do not have to have epiczones.admin permissions to make changes to that zone. They also cannot change anthying that would affect the size of the zone. (points, ceiling, floor, radius)

    To delete a zone, use the /zone edit command, then /zone delete followed by /zone confirm. That will delete the zone in question.

    In builds of EpicZones before 0.27, its recommended to issue a /ezreload command after modifying zones. This is fixed in 0.27 going forward, which has yet to be released.

    jblaske

    Currently, there are two ways to tell what zone you are in.
    a) use the /who command, it will show you the zone you are in.
    b) use enter/exit messages on your zones to announce when you are in a zone.

    There is another coming in 0.27 to tell what zone you are in, if you are running a spout enabled client.

    If you are an admin, or owner of a zone. you can edit the zone and add permissions for other players through the commands.

    jblaske

    Version 0.27 is now out! I've enhanced the language file system, and now you get 3 languages included by default. If anybody wants to translate EpicZones into another language, feel free and submit a ticket and we can work it out!

    EpicZones now supports Spout, very small features right now - but more will come in future versions (Like a window to modify your zone properties rather than using commands?!?!)

    The next release is planned to enhance the useability of EpicZones so it is less tedious to use. If there is something that bothers you that you wish was easier, please submit a ticket so I can look into it.

    Enjoy!
    • Version 0.27
      • Added Spout functionality.
        • Current zone is displayed in the top right corner of the users display, if they are running a spoutcraft enabled client.
        • Pressing F4 toggles display of XYZ of player along the top of the screen.
      • New zones will default the following values to the same as the global zone the zone is created within.
        • Ceiling
        • Explode
        • Fire
        • FireBurnsMobs
        • Floor
        • Mobs
        • PVP
        • Regen
        • Sanctuary
      • Fixed serveral bugs that were causing log files to get out of hand.
      • Enhanced Multi-Language support, currently included languages
        • English (EN_US)
        • German (DE_DE)
        • French (FR_FR)
